Fate.

You meet a random man, in a random cafe on a random street. You arrived after watching a random movie that wasn't your idea and had randomly decided to go to this cafe to read. It wasn't that this cafe held any significance to you in the first place. It wasn't that the moment you peered into that window that you knew you had to go in. It wasn't that you had been there before and had loved the coffee, the atmosphere and the style. It was just random.
The man, however, worked there. After moving to a randomly chosen city for a random reason he sub-consciously decided, to walk down a random street to find a job to pay for his apartment he so happened to find in this randomly chosen city. He just happened to walk down this particular street and found this random cafe that had a vacancy.
The cafe owner had been persuaded to fire one of his staff that morning. He was planning on firing him a month ago but his conscience told him to keep him on a little longer. But that morning a close friend and co-worker had told him, out of anger and frustration, to 'just do it already'. This, therefore, left a vacancy that this man took months before your day out led you to this ever so random cafe.
This co-worker who was, as we now know, angry and frustrated on this random morning, had gotten into a fight an hour before work. Her and her husband had been arguing about this particular topic for the last week. Her sister had been in a random car accident the week before but she hadn't wanted to visit due to her childhood relationship. But her husband disagreed. He wanted her to visit because 'she is a blood relative and that means more than petty childhood arguments'. And so the co-worker had been angry and frustrated.
During the morning of the random accident, the co-worker's sister had been upset. Her best friend, since nursery, hated her. All because of one stupid, random, drunken mistake where she had slept with her best friend's boyfriend. They had argued all night; she had tried to explain to her best friend that it was a mistake and that she was sorry but her best friend didn't want to know, she didn't want to talk and she used words synonymous to hate and eternity. All this led up to the co-worker's sister singing an off-key, hiccupy rendition of 'All By Myself' in her car that random rainy morning. She was apathetic towards the world which caused a sensory delay when a car randomly spun out of control and hit the passenger side.
All of these events are out of your control and, as previously mentioned, random. So why is it that on that random day, in that random cafe on that random street after that random movie, that you met the man of your dreams?
